"An Orchestra of Minorities" is a novel written by Chigozie Obioma, a Nigerian author, and was published in 2019. The book is Obioma's second novel, following the success of his debut work, "The Fishermen."

Plot Summary:
The novel tells the story of Chinonso, a young poultry farmer from a small village in Nigeria. Chinonso's life takes a dramatic turn when he saves a woman named Ndali from committing suicide by jumping off a bridge. Touched by his act of heroism, Ndali, who comes from a wealthy and educated family, becomes enamored with Chinonso and seeks to help him improve his life.
Chinonso and Ndali's love story faces numerous obstacles due to their differing social backgrounds and the disapproval of Ndali's family. Despite these challenges, Chinonso is determined to prove his worth and make a life with Ndali.
To seek a better life and education, Chinonso sells his property and enrolls in a college in Cyprus. However, once he arrives in Cyprus, he faces a series of misfortunes and cruel treatment, which plunge him into despair. During this time, Chinonso's only companion is his chi, his personal guardian spirit, who acts as a narrator and intermediary between the earthly and spirit realms.
As the novel unfolds, it explores themes of fate, choice, love, sacrifice, and the interplay between the physical and spiritual worlds. The story is deeply rooted in Igbo cosmology and mythology, with the chi representing a central aspect of Igbo belief and spirituality.
The narrative is structured as a chi's plea in the spirit world, making a case for Chinonso's redemption after a terrible incident that occurs in Cyprus. Through this unique narrative perspective, the novel delves into the complexities of human desires and motivations and examines the consequences of actions that ripple through time and space.
Chigozie Obioma's "An Orchestra of Minorities" is praised for its rich storytelling, vivid prose, and exploration of cultural and philosophical themes. The novel received widespread acclaim and was shortlisted for various literary awards, solidifying Obioma's reputation as a talented and important contemporary African writer.
